C1 Esterase Inhibitor (C1INH-nf) for the Treatment of Acute Hereditary Angioedema (HAE) Attacks
RandomizedParallel-groupDouble-blindTreatment
Summary
The study objective was to determine the safety and efficacy of C1INH-nf for the treatment of acute HAE attacks.
